New Findings Shed Light on Water
The nature of science is never to stop questioning. For the most part,
this works to our benefit. New research is conducted, new ideas surface,
new evidence comes to light, and as is often the case, the old way of
thinking is proven to be, at the very least, ineffective or at worst,
harmful.
In the case of distilled water, we fall somewhere in
between in the research findings. Recent studies show, that while drinking
low mineral water will not wreak major damage on the body immediately,
over time, it can strip the body of vital minerals such as calcium,
potassium and magnesium among others.
